Target Background

Function
Lignin degradation and detoxification of lignin-derived products. Required for secondary xylem cell wall lignification.
Gene References into Functions
  1. A laccase gene, LAC4, regulated by a microRNA, miR397b, controls both lignin biosynthesis and seed yield in Arabidopsis. PMID: 24975689
  2. Simultaneous disruption of LAC11 along with LAC4 and LAC17 causes severe plant growth arrest, narrower root diameter, indehiscent anthers, and vascular development arrest with lack of lignification. PMID: 24143805
  3. Disruption of LAC4 affects plant development, vascular tissues, lignification, and saccharification efficiency to various extents. PMID: 21447792
Subcellular Location
Secreted, extracellular space, apoplast.
Protein Families
Multicopper oxidase family
Tissue Specificity
Ubiquitous, with higher levels in the inflorescence stem.
